In a market place in which practical payment choices are paramount, providing a diverse range of payment solutions is crucial. This makes certain a frictionless expertise for gamers, resulting in greater consumer retention and diversified income streams.Payment method. Signing up to an online casino and discovering they do not settle for your prefe